147 - aischrokerdós

Strong's Concordance

Original word: αἰσχροκερδῶς
Transliteration: aischrokerdós
Definition (short): gain
Definition (full): from eagerness for base gain

NAS Exhaustive Concordance

Word Origin: adverb from aischrokerdés
Definition: from eagerness for base gain
NASB Translation: sordid gain (1).

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

Adverb from aischrokerdes; sordidly -- for filthy lucre's sake.

see GREEK aischrokerdes

KJV: Feed the flock of God which is among you, taking the oversight thereof, not by constraint, but willingly; not for filthy lucre, but of a ready mind;
NASB: shepherd the flock of God among you, exercising oversight not under compulsion, but voluntarily, according to the will of God; and not for sordid gain, but with eagerness;
